The whale shark is a filter feeder which, like baleen whales, eats small organisms such as krill, that it filters out of the water. Of course like all oceanic life, it drinks sea water.

NO - you're thinking of a scavenger - A filter feeder eats plankton and other small particles in the sea. They pull water through their body, straining it for food - push the water back out and eat any solids found.

A whale shark is a filter feeder; it sifts plankton and small shrimps from the water it swims through.
